#include <stdio.h>
#include <stdlib.h>
#include <string.h>
#include "eca-control-interface.h"
/* FIXME: cannot be run on a clean-build as ecasound is not yet
* installed */
/* ---------------------------------------------------------------------
* Options
*/
#define VERBOSE
/* ---------------------------------------------------------------------
* Test util macros
*/
#ifdef VERBOSE
#define ECA_TEST_ENTRY() printf("%s:%d - Test started", __FILE__, __LINE__)
#define ECA_TEST_SUCCESS() printf("\n%s:%d - Test passed\n", __FILE__, __LINE__); return 0
#define ECA_TEST_FAIL(x,y) printf("\n%s:%d - Test failed: \"%s\"\n", __FILE__, __LINE__, y); return x
#define ECA_TEST_CASE() printf("."); fflush(stdout)
#define ECA_TEST_TRACE(x) do { x; } while(0)
#else
#define ECA_TEST_ENTRY() ((void) 0)
#define ECA_TEST_SUCCESS() return 0
#define ECA_TEST_FAIL(x,y) return x
#define ECA_TEST_CASE() ((void) 0)
#define ECA_TEST_TRACE(x) do { ; } while(0)
#endif
/* ---------------------------------------------------------------------
* Type definitions
*/
typedef int (*eci_test_t)(void);
/* ---------------------------------------------------------------------
* Test case declarations
*/
static int eci_test_1(void);
static eci_test_t eci_funcs[] = {
eci_test_1,
NULL
};
/* ---------------------------------------------------------------------
* Funtion definitions
*/
int main(int argc, char *argv[])
{
int n, failed = 0;
#ifdef NDEBUG
const char *binpath = "ECASOUND=" TEST_TOP_BUILDDIR "/ecasound/ecasound";
#else
const char *binpath = "ECASOUND=" TEST_TOP_BUILDDIR "/ecasound/ecasound_debug";
#endif
ECA_TEST_TRACE(printf("Running %s tests with %s.\n", __FILE__, binpath));
putenv((char *)binpath);
for(n = 0; eci_funcs[n] != NULL; n++) {
int ret = eci_funcs[n]();
if (ret != 0) {
++failed;
}
}
return failed;
}
static int eci_test_1(void)
{
ECA_CONTROL_INTERFACE handle;
int count;
ECA_TEST_ENTRY();
handle.command("cs-remove");
handle.command("cs-status");
handle.command("cs-list");
count = handle.last_string_list().size();
if (count != 0) { ECA_TEST_FAIL(1, "cs-list count not zero"); }
handle.command("cs-add test_cs2");
handle.command("cs-list");
count = handle.last_string_list().size();
if (count != 1) { ECA_TEST_FAIL(2, "cs-list count not one"); }
if (handle.last_string_list()[0] != "test_cs2") {
ECA_TEST_FAIL(3, "cs name does not match");
}
ECA_TEST_SUCCESS();
}
